The Harrowgate payments adapter calls the Velastra upstream API through a circuit breaker in the Tollan proxy layer. When the failure ratio crosses its threshold, the breaker opens and all requests are served a signed static denial — no partial responses leave the boundary, which matters for audit integrity. Half-open probes are rate-limited and logged with full request metadata for later review. Note that breaker thresholds are not hardcoded; reviewers should confirm the deployed settings match the approved baseline values listed below.

deployment values, tagug-tagaf:
[zorix]
team = druix
access_code = ac_42e3e2
host = zorix.qirvancorp.test
port = 6379
owner = beldor.gordor
peer = kelath.zemvarcorp.test

# Userforge — Environments

Userforge is the user module split out of the Hollowbrick monolith. Three environments: dev, staging, prod. Staging mirrors prod data weekly, scrubbed. Support: escalate auth failures in prod only; dev and staging flake by design. Logins route through Userforge since the March cut-over. Current prod configuration follows.

service settings:
PRAIX_LOG_LEVEL=error
PRAIX_METRICS_HOST=metrics.praix.qorvelcorp.corp
PRAIX_POOL_SIZE=16

- [ ] **Data-centre cage visit (Denholm Park, Hall C).** Escort the new starter to the cage for their orientation walkthrough. Confirm beforehand that their induction record shows the safety briefing as complete, and that they are wearing closed-toe shoes — no exceptions in Hall C. Both of you must sign the cage register at the inner door, noting time in and time out. The cage keypad is on the left-hand pillar; enter the current access code shown below.

door code, yagap-bahof: bdg-O-05